Inclusiveness, Diversity & Equity

Semiotics has been recruited by various clients to provide technical assistance on Inclusiveness, Diversity and  Equity issues. Semiotics team has conceptualized, designed, developed and implemented numerous programs and projects. The work involved the policy framework, enabling environment and embedding IDE measures.

Women and development studies pertain to strengthening the capacity of the government to reform institutions and systems dealing with the issues of gender and development, designing policy and institutional mechanisms for gender mainstreaming for government and media, analyzing situation of provision of justice (particularly for women) and gender violence cases, mapping gender dimensions of employment trends and opportunities for women in hospitality industry and identifying skill deficits in the sector.
